How to Convert Pound/Gallon (UK) to Pound/Gallon (US)
To convert from Pound/Gallon (UK) (lb/gal (UK)) to Pound/Gallon (US) (lb/gal), multiply the value by 0.8326741846.
Formula: lb/gal = lb/gal (UK) × 0.8326741846
Reverse: lb/gal (UK) = lb/gal × 1.2009499255
Step-by-Step Example
- Start with your value in Pound/Gallon (UK). For example: 5 lb/gal (UK)
- Multiply by the conversion factor: 5 x 0.8326741846
- The result is: 4.163371 lb/gal
About Pound/Gallon (UK)
The pound/gallon (uk) (lb/gal (UK)) is a unit of density. One pound/gallon (uk) equals 99.77637266 kilogram per cubic metres. About Pound/Gallon (US)
The pound/gallon (us) (lb/gal) is a unit of density. One pound/gallon (us) equals 119.8264273 kilogram per cubic metres. UnitConvertLab converts it against every other density unit using this exact definition, so results are reproducible to full double precision rather than rounded lookup tables.
